NetWorker: Epäjohdonmukaisten NSR-vertaistietojen korjaaminen
摘要: NSR-vertaistietovirhe varmuuskopioinnin ja palautuksen aikana. On jo olemassa kone, joka käyttää nimeä (client_name). Valitse joko toinen nimi koneellesi tai poista "NSR peer information" -merkintä kohdasta (client_name) isännässä: (host_name) ' ...
症狀
Varmuuskopiointi, palautus ja tietoliikenne epäonnistuvat työasemassa ja seuraavat virheet:
'nsrexecd: SYSTEM error: There is already a machine using the name (client_name). Either choose a different name for your machine, or delete the "NSR peer information" entry for (client_name) on host: (host_name)'
'nsrexecd: SYSTEM error: Connection reset by peer'
nsrexecd.exe voi aiheuttaa sovellusvirheitä yhdessä tai useammassa asiakasohjelmassa, kuten palvelimessa tai tallennussolmuissa.
原因
res\nsrladb-kansio on uuden varmennepohjaisen isäntätodennuksen (nsrauth) koti. Se sisältää sekä yksittäisen asiakkaan paikallisen varmenteen että välimuistissa olevan kopion kaikista isännistä, joiden kanssa se on kommunikoinut.
Ensimmäisellä yhteyskerralla isäntä pyytää ja vastaanottaa sen isännän varmenteen, johon se muodostaa yhteyden, sekä tallentaa palvelimen varmenteen välimuistiin tulevaa vertailua varten. Ohjattuja palautuksia ja tallennussolmuja lukuun ottamatta vakioympäristössä kukin asiakasvarmenne tallennetaan välimuistiin NetWorker-palvelimessa ja tallennussolmuissa ja palvelimen varmenne tallennetaan välimuistiin kussakin asiakasohjelmassa ja tallennussolmussa. Nämä välimuistiin tallennetut varmenteet näkyvät määrityspuun Local Hosts -haarassa
Kun asiakas asennetaan uudelleen, varmenne luodaan uudelleen paikallisesti asiakasohjelmassa. Tämä aiheuttaa asiakkaan varmenteen palvelimen välimuistissa olevan kopion mitätöinnin, mikä aiheuttaa virheet. Sama ehto johtuu yksinkertaisesti nimeämällä nsrladb uudelleen asiakkaassa.
解析度
NSR-vertaistiedot asetetaan asiakastasolla, ei palvelintasolla. Toisin sanoen: sinun on muodostettava yhteys NSRLA: han, ei NSR-tietokantaan. Tätä varten on muodostettava yhteys "nsradmin -p nsrexec" tai "nsrådmin -p nsrexecd". nsradmin muodostaa itsessään yhteyden NetWorker-palvelimeen.
Poista asiakkaan (client_name) vanha varmenne, joka ei vastaa vastaavuutta/välimuistiin ja luo virheilmoituksen (host_name). Jos NetWorker-palvelin on päivitetty tai asennettu uudelleen, palvelinvarmenne on poistettava jokaisesta asiakkaasta nsrauthin vahvaa todennusta käyttäen. Kummassakin tapauksessa korjaava toimenpide on sama ja yksi seuraavista:
- Poista asiakkaan varmenne, joka on päivitetty mistä tahansa isännästä ja kopio vanhasta NMC: n paikallisten isäntien kautta
- Poista vanha/välimuistissa oleva varmenne asiakkaasta, jota ongelma koskee, komentorivin avulla
Asiakaskoneen vertaistietojen tyhjentäminen (palvelimesta)
nsradmin -s <host_name> -p nsrexec
nsradmin> delete type: nsr peer information; peer hostname: <client_name>
Vertaistietojen tyhjentäminen asiakaskoneessa
nsradmin -p nsrexec
nsradmin> print type: nsr peer information
delete
其他資訊
Kiertotapa version mukaan:
- NSRAUTHIN poistaminen käytöstä vain palvelin- ja tallennussolmuissa (ja NW:n uudelleenkäynnistys) ratkaisee tämän ongelman lopullisesti.
- Aseta NetWorker-palvelin nsrauth- tai nsrauth-/oldauth-tilaan.
NetWorker 7.5.x-, 7.6.x- tai 8.0-palvelimia oldauth-tilassa ei voi käyttää NMC 8.0:n kanssa, joka on oletusarvoisesti nsrauth/oldauth-tilassa.